Partners for Inclusion is delighted to be recruiting a Service Leader to join our experienced leadership team, working across Pan Ayrshire, East Renfrewshire, and Renfrewshire. We are an independent charity providing highly individualised support to people with learning disabilities and/or mental health needs. Our approach is rooted in human rights and person-led practice, believing everyone has the right to live their best life, shape their own support, and achieve their goals.
About the Role
As a Service Leader, you will inspire and develop several support teams, ensuring the people we support experience meaningful, high-quality lives. You will:
- Lead with a person-centred and flexible approach.
- Support positive risk-taking and uphold best practice.
- Build strong, trusted relationships with people supported, families, teams, and professionals.
- Promote high standards aligned to the Health and Social Care Standards and SSSC Codes of Practice.
- Participate in the organisational on-call rota, offering out-of-hours guidance.
About You:
You are an inspirational leader who shares our values and commitment to inclusion. You bring:
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ills.
- Experience leading or developing staff teams in social care or a related field.
- A genuine belief in human rights and person-led approaches.
- The ability to motivate, manage change, and foster respect and collaboration.
- Membership with the PVG Scheme.
- Ability to register with the SSSC within three months of employment.
- SVQ 4 (or working towards), or a minimum of SVQ 3 with a commitment to complete SVQ 4 in Social Care/Management.
